Abstract

A kind of rotary suction nozzle pot lid device includes pot lid unit and suction cover unit.The pot lid unit includes being covered on the pot lid body of pot mouth with opening and be extended by the pot lid body along extending direction and outer surface is formed with externally threaded suction nozzle column.The suction nozzle column defines the outlet group that the liquid can be supplied to contain space outflow from this.The suction cover unit is penetrated through along the extending direction, and is sheathed on the suction nozzle column, and inner surface is formed with and screws togather the externally threaded internal thread.The suction cover unit can be moved by spiral shell and moved along the extending direction relative to the suction nozzle column, to allow or stop that the liquid flows out.The suction cover unit is spirally connected with the suction nozzle column, and do not have that the suction cover unit surprisingly pulled open happens, and can finely tune the suction cover unit in a rotative pattern for user, has the advantages that be beneficial to control liquid outlet quantity.

Background technology
In order to ensure national health, the concept of good exercise habit is formed, is all widelyd popularize and is led with a surname all the time.With The passage of time, movement general mood is more and more prevailing at present, and such as gymnasium is fitted with body can train place more and more, bicycle Travelling is also quite luxuriant to be popular, however is either engaged in which kind of movement, timely and appropriately supplements what is be lost in during the motion Moisture content is an important thing.
In order to reach the purpose to keep the skin wet and take into account environmental protection, many people can carry Sports water container when moving.Due to In motion process, the movement range of body is larger, and in order to avoid user absorbs excess moisture, componental movement water in the short time Pot system is adopted suction nozzle design and is drunk with sharp user.Refering to Fig. 1,2, a kind of previous Sports water container, including one can contain water or The bottle body 11 of the liquid such as beverage, the pot lid device 12 being covered on opening in the bottle body 11 with one.The pot lid device 12 wraps Include suction nozzle column of the pot lid body 121, one that can be arranged at the bottle body 11 by the pot lid body 121 up projection Unscrew 122 and a suction cover 123 being sheathed on the suction nozzle column 122.The suction cover 123 can be up opened with respect to the suction nozzle column 122 Or be depressed, liquid to be controlled to flow out or stop the liquid from the suction nozzle column 122 with being somebody's turn to do from the suction nozzle column 122 and the suction cover 123 Suction cover 123 flows out.The drawing and pulling type switch designs of the suction cover 123 although quite being facilitated using upper, but still are had the shortcomings that, example Such as the suction cover 123 may be pulled open by unexpected and leak out liquid, and the suction cover 123 is also more difficult quantitatively controls water yield, need Further improve.

Specific embodiment
In the following description content, similar or identical element will be represented with being identically numbered.
Refering to Fig. 3,4, a first embodiment of the utility model rotary suction nozzle pot lid device, suitable for a bottle body of arranging in pairs or groups 2 use.The bottle body 2 define one can containing liquid contain space 21 and one connects the pot mouth for containing space 21 22.This first embodiment includes a pot lid unit 3 being arranged in the bottle body 2 and one is arranged on the pot lid unit 3 Suction cover unit 4.
The pot lid unit 3 include one it is general in it is circular and be covered on opening the pot mouth 22 pot lid body 31 and One suction nozzle column 32 up extended by the extending direction D1 of the pot lid body 31 central inner edge along a upward and downward.The suction nozzle column 32 is general It is cylindrical, and have there are one androgynous 33, one, the extra heavy pipe portion up extended by the pot lid body 31 with the extra heavy pipe portion 33 between the upper and lower Every round block portion 34 and several consubstantialities be connected to rib portion 35 between the extra heavy pipe portion 33 and the round block portion 34.The extra heavy pipe portion 33 Top form spacing ring 331 there are one annular in shape and projection radially outward, and outer surface forms that there are one be located at the pot lid External screw thread 332 between body 31 and the spacing ring 331.Each rib portion 35 is tilted upward inside by the top in the extra heavy pipe portion 33 to be extended Ground connects the round block portion 34 and is in generally spoke shape.Such rib portion 35 and the extra heavy pipe portion 33 and the round block portion 34, are engaged and define One outlet group 36 that can be passed in and out for liquid.The outlet group 36 includes several equiangularly spaced liquid outlets 361 each other.
The suction cover unit 4 includes inside and outside one connect together one with inner cap body made of hard material 41 and one With outer cover 42 made of soft material.The hard material is for example plastic cement.The soft material is for example For rubber.The outer cover 42 is made with soft material with the agreeable to the taste characteristic convenient for drinking.
The inner cap body 41 is socketed on the suction nozzle column 32, and with a narrow wide diameter part 411 of internal diameter one wide one and one narrow Footpath portion 412 and one are connected between the wide diameter part 411 and the narrow diameter section 412 and positioned at the spacing ring 331 in the extra heavy pipe portion 33 Top and shoulder 413 annular in shape.The wide diameter part 411 supplies 33 grafting of extra heavy pipe portion of the suction nozzle column 32, and inner surface is formed with The internal thread 414 screwed togather with the external screw thread 332 in extra heavy pipe portion 33 and one is annular in shape and radially projection and compartment of terrain inside Baffle ring 415 positioned at the shoulder 413 and 331 lower section of spacing ring.The baffle ring 415 can stop the spacing ring 331, thick to avoid this Pipe portion 33 departs from the wide diameter part 411.The narrow diameter section 412 is for the round block portion 34 adaptation grafting of the suction nozzle column 32.
There are one be in generally hollow round table shape and be sheathed on this cover 421 and two of the inner cap body 41 for the outer cover 42 tool A flank section 422 radially extended opposite to each other by this cover 421 (because of visual angle and cutting schematic relationships, is only shown in each figure Meaning one of which, another one system are symmetrically arranged).Each flank section 422 is arranged on the bottom side of this cover 421, and radially By interior be tapered outward generally in wing, streamline is simplified, and easy to operation.
Refering to Fig. 4,5, which can be moved by spiral shell and be moved along extending direction D1 relative to the suction nozzle column 32, and energy It is converted between a closed position as shown in Figure 4 and an open position as shown in Figure 5.
In the closed position, the round block portion 34 of the suction nozzle column 32 is inserted in the narrow diameter section 412 of the inner cap body 41, should The shoulder 413 of inner cap body 41 abuts the top in such rib portion 35.At this point, although liquid can be flowed out by such liquid outlet 361, But the shoulder 413 can be subject to be engaged stop with the round block portion 34, and can not be flowed out by the narrow diameter section 412.
Such flank section 422 is abutted with finger, the outer cover 42 is rotated and the inner cap body 41 is driven to rotate together with, the suction can be made Cap unit 4 is up moved relative to the suction nozzle column 32, and is converted to the open position.In the open position, the round block portion 34 not position In the narrow diameter section 412, and in the wide diameter part 411, the shoulder 413 also with such rib portion 35 between the upper and lower every so that from The liquid that such liquid outlet 361 leaves can be flowed through between the round block portion 34 and the shoulder 413, and is flowed out from the narrow diameter section 412.
Refering to Fig. 6, a second embodiment of the utility model rotary suction nozzle pot lid device is similar with the first embodiment, Different places is that the length of 421 upward and downward of this cover is shorter, and 422 system of such flank section is formed at the inner cap body 41 Wide diameter part 411.
The effect of the utility model rotary suction nozzle pot lid device, is:The suction cover unit 4 and 32 system of suction nozzle column spiral shell each other Connect, do not have the suction cover unit 4 and pulled open by unexpected and made happening for liquid leakage, and be spirally connected design can also for user with Rotation mode finely tunes the position of the suction cover unit 4, has the advantages that being beneficial to user controls liquid outlet quantity.The first embodiment is somebody's turn to do Etc. flank sections 422 then there is amplifying moment in order to rotate and finely tune.
